 A research proposal is a document that systematically describes the purpose, methods, schedule, budget, and other elements of a planned study. It serves as a guide for planning and carrying out a research project and is often submitted to funding bodies or academic institutions. A research proposal commonly includes the following elements.
When preparing an undergraduate thesis research proposal within a university, it is especially important to describe the study systematically and in sufficient detail by following the steps below.
The following guidance is intended to help students carry out research projects efficiently and meaningfully.

Step 1: Title

 Set a title that concisely represents the content of the study. Aim for wording that is specific and easy to understand. A good title should communicate the study accurately and succinctly. The following points can help when developing an effective title.

1. Clarify the Main Subject of the Study
Choose words that specifically indicate the topic or problem addressed in the study. Confirm that the title accurately reflects the research content.

2. Keep It Concise
Omit unnecessary prepositions and conjunctions and use only the words needed to convey the topic. As a general guideline, a title of roughly 10–15 words is often considered appropriate.

3. Include Keywords
Including important keywords from the research field can improve visibility in searches and help make clear what the study is about.

4. Attract the Reader's Interest
Use wording that is likely to interest the intended audience. A question format or wording focused on results or implications may be effective when appropriate.

5. Indicate the Research Method or Type of Data
When appropriate, mention the research method, such as a case study or meta-analysis, or identify a particular dataset. Stating the methodology can help indicate the scope and depth of the research.

6. Review and Refine Repeatedly
Develop several possible titles and evaluate the strengths and weaknesses of each.
Ask your supervisor or colleagues for feedback and use it to decide on the final title.

The title is the “face” of a research paper and is often the first part seen by readers. A title can therefore strongly influence initial interest and understanding. Use the guidelines above to create a title that communicates the content of the research accurately and attractively.



Step 2: Research Background

 When writing the research background, provide a clear and persuasive explanation that allows readers to understand why the study matters. This section establishes the basis for understanding the importance of the topic and the purpose of the research. The following points explain how to write an effective research background.

1. Overview of the Research Field
Provide basic information about the field related to the topic and establish the current level of knowledge and understanding. Explain why the field is important and identify relevant social or academic concerns.

2. Identify the Problem
Specify the particular problem or gap that the study addresses. Emphasize issues that remain unresolved or have been treated inadequately in existing research or theory.

3. Review Previous Studies
Briefly review relevant previous studies and explain how your research builds on, extends, or challenges them. Cite important findings or theories and show how they relate to the current research problem.

4. Significance of the Research
Explain not only the academic importance of the study but also any practical or social significance. Highlight possible changes, improvements, or contributions that the findings may produce.

5. Research Purpose and Research Questions
State the main purpose of the study clearly and formulate the specific research questions it seeks to address. The research purpose should indicate how the study aims to provide a solution, explanation, or deeper understanding of the problem.

6. Scope of the Research
Define the scope of the study, including the regions, time periods, populations, or variables covered. It is also important to recognize limitations and explain how they may affect the findings.

7. Formulate Hypotheses, If Applicable
State clear hypotheses and indicate the expected relationships or outcomes. Hypotheses should be based on the research questions and must be testable.

8. Structure of the Study
Briefly explain the structure of the research proposal and outline the content to be covered in each chapter or section.

By combining these elements carefully, readers can understand the background from which the study emerges and the value it is intended to provide. The research background is an important part of the introduction to a proposal or paper and helps establish the tone and direction of the entire study.

Step 3: Research Purpose

 The research purpose is a central element of a research proposal or paper. It guides the entire study and is essential for defining the significance, direction, and focus of the research. The following steps help clarify and describe the research purpose.

1. Identify the Focus of the Research
Clarify the specific problem or question the study seeks to address. Narrow the scope and determine the particular area or issue on which the research will focus.

2. State the Research Purpose Specifically
Describe the concrete goals the study seeks to achieve. State clearly what you intend to discover, demonstrate, clarify, or develop. If there are multiple objectives, distinguish and list them separately.

3. Use the SMART Criteria
Specific: The objective should be concrete and clear. Measurable: It should be possible to evaluate the degree of achievement. Achievable: It should be realistic within the available resources and time. Relevant: It should be meaningful and related to the broader research problem or goal. Time-bound: A clear timeline should be established for achieving the objective.

4. Connect the Purpose to the Significance of the Study
Explain how the research purpose contributes to academic discussion, practice, or policy. Address the potential impact and possible applications of the findings and emphasize the broader value of the study.

5. Use Clear and Precise Language
Choose language that is technically appropriate while remaining understandable. Define specialized terms when necessary and clarify their meaning in the context of the study.

6. Engage the Reader
The statement of research purpose should be written in a way that draws the reader's interest. If readers can understand why the study matters at this stage, they are more likely to remain engaged with the rest of the document.
A clearly stated research purpose contributes directly to a successful research plan. The clearer the purpose, the easier it is to maintain a consistent direction and focus throughout the research process.

Step 4: Research Methods

 The research methods section explains specifically what procedures and techniques will be used to address the research purpose and questions. A clear description of methods is important for improving the transparency, reproducibility, and reliability of the study. The major elements are outlined below.

1. Research Design
Research type: Specify whether the study is qualitative, quantitative, or mixed methods and explain why this approach is appropriate. Research structure: Identify the framework, such as a case study, survey, experiment, cohort study, longitudinal study, or cross-sectional study.

2. Data Collection Methods
Type of data: State whether primary data collected directly or secondary data from existing sources will be used. Specific methods: Describe the methods used to collect data, such as interviews, questionnaires, observation, literature review, or experiments. Sampling: Explain how the sample will be selected, such as random, stratified, or convenience sampling, and state the planned sample size.

3. Data Analysis Methods
Qualitative analysis: Explain how qualitative data will be analyzed, such as content analysis, thematic analysis, or discourse analysis. Quantitative analysis: Describe the statistical methods to be used, such as descriptive statistics, inferential statistics, regression analysis, or ANOVA. Software: Identify statistical or qualitative-analysis tools, such as SPSS, R, or NVivo, when applicable.

4. Ethical Considerations
Participant consent: Explain how consent will be obtained for the collection and use of participants' information. Privacy and confidentiality: Describe how collected data and participants' privacy will be protected. Ethics review: If approval by an ethics committee is required, describe the relevant process.

5. Limitations
Study limitations: Evaluate and describe methodological limitations, potential biases, and other constraints honestly. Mitigation: Explain strategies for minimizing the effects of these limitations on the findings.

6. Ensuring Reliability and Validity
Reliability: Explain how the study will maintain consistency and, where applicable, reproducibility. Validity: Explain how well the methods and findings address the stated research purpose and questions.
The methods section provides a basis for evaluating the accuracy and credibility of the research. Describing these elements clearly makes it easier for other researchers to assess the study and, where appropriate, reproduce it.

Step 5: Research Schedule

 A research schedule is an important part of project planning. It helps ensure that each phase proceeds according to a clear timeline and provides a framework for managing progress and meeting research objectives within the available time. The principal steps for preparing a detailed research schedule are described below.

1. Define the Research Phases
Divide the project into phases. These commonly include preparation, data collection, data analysis, writing up results, and review and revision. Clearly define the main activities and objectives of each phase.

2. Create a Timeline
Set start and end dates for each phase based on the total project period and deadlines. A calendar or Gantt chart can make the schedule easier to visualize, track, and manage.

3. Establish Milestones
Include important checkpoints or milestones in the timeline. These may include ethics approval, completion of major data collection, or submission of a first draft. Milestones serve as reference points for measuring progress.

4. Allow for Flexibility
Unexpected delays or problems may occur during research, so the schedule should include some flexibility. Building in buffer time can make it easier to respond to unforeseen delays.

5. Consider Resources and Dependencies
Confirm that necessary resources, including personnel, equipment, and funding, will be available during each phase. Clarify how one phase depends on another and adjust the schedule accordingly.

6. Review and Update Regularly
A research schedule is a dynamic document that should be updated as the project progresses. Review it regularly and make adjustments when necessary.

7. Document and Share the Schedule
Document the research schedule and share it with relevant stakeholders, such as the research team, supervisor, or funding body. Maintaining transparency helps everyone understand the project's progress and respond appropriately.
Detailed planning and management of the research schedule are essential to the successful completion of a research project. Setting a clear schedule and managing it effectively makes achievement of the research goals more likely.

Step 6: Expected Outcomes and Dissemination

 In a research proposal, the section on “Expected Outcomes and Dissemination” explains what the study is expected to produce and how those outcomes will be used after the research is completed. This section is important for demonstrating both the practical value and academic contribution of the study. The following guidelines can help structure it effectively.

1. Identify the Research Outcomes
Concrete outcomes: Specify the outputs expected directly from the study. Depending on the project, these may include new data, theoretical advances, technological innovations, policy recommendations, treatment approaches, or software tools.
Academic outputs: Specify contributions to the academic community, such as journal papers, conference presentations, books, or book chapters.
Formats: State the form in which outputs will be delivered, such as journal articles, conference presentations, white papers, patents, or prototypes.

2. Impact of the Outcomes
Academic impact: Explain how the study may deepen knowledge or understanding in the field or provide new insights into existing theories or models.
Industry and social impact: Describe possible concrete changes that technological innovations or policy recommendations could bring to industry or society.
Application to policy or practice: Explain how the findings may be useful to policymakers, practitioners, or the wider public.

3. Dissemination and Utilization Plan
Dissemination activities: Plan how the results will be communicated. This may include journal submission, conference presentations, workshops, and sharing information through websites or blogs.
Promoting collaboration: Consider how cooperation with other researchers or institutions could extend the impact of the findings.
Commercialization: If the outcomes may have commercial value, consider possible routes to market, including business planning, entrepreneurship, or partnerships with industry.

4. Long-Term Perspective
Sustainability: Consider how the outcomes may continue to be used over the long term.
Pathways for future research: Explain how the current study may provide a foundation for subsequent research projects.

5. Timeline and Resources
Schedule for achieving outcomes: Present the planned timeline for producing each major output.
Required resources: Identify any additional funding, equipment, personnel, or other resources needed to achieve and disseminate the outcomes.

Describing the expected outcomes and their dissemination in detail helps demonstrate that a research plan is practical and capable of producing meaningful impact. It also enables funding bodies and other stakeholders to assess the value of the research project more clearly.

Step 7: References

 References in a research proposal or academic paper are important for showing that the study is grounded in existing knowledge and for supporting the reliability and coherence of the research. Proper referencing makes the sources of information clear to readers and improves transparency. The following points explain how to prepare references effectively.

1. Selecting References
Relevance: Select literature directly related to the research topic, including important sources that influence the theoretical background, previous studies, methodology, data analysis, and discussion.
Reliability: Give priority to information from published journals, academic books, and reliable online sources. Peer-reviewed journal articles are generally regarded as particularly reliable academic sources.
Currency: Cite recent research where appropriate, while also including classic or foundational literature that remains important to the field.

2. Choosing a Citation Style
Consistency: Use one citation style consistently, such as APA, MLA, Chicago, or Harvard, in accordance with the standards of the academic field.
Style guide: If your supervisor or the journal to which you plan to submit specifies a particular style guide, follow those instructions.

3. Writing Citations
In-text citations: When citing information in the text, include the author's name and year of publication. Example: (Smith, 2020).
Direct quotations: When quoting directly, also include the page number. Example: (Smith, 2020, p. 32).

4. Preparing the Reference List
Alphabetical order: Arrange entries alphabetically by the author's surname.
Complete information: Include the author, year of publication, book title and publisher, or for journal articles, the journal title, volume and issue, and page range.
Electronic resources: When citing online sources, include the access date and URL or DOI (Digital Object Identifier) as required by the citation style.

5. Using Software Tools
Reference-management software: Tools such as EndNote, Zotero, and Mendeley can help organize citations and reference lists, reduce errors, and save time.

6. Copyright and Ethical Considerations
Respect for copyright: Follow copyright law, especially when quoting source material directly, and obtain permission when required.
Preventing plagiarism: Paraphrase and summarize appropriately in your own words and cite all sources correctly to avoid plagiarism.

Accurate referencing in research proposals and papers is essential for establishing credibility and positioning research within the academic community. Appropriate use of references strengthens the foundation of a study and supports the validity of its conclusions.
